Listed by Yianni Mooney PropertyYianni Mooney Property proudly presents to the market 33 Whitehaven Way, Pelican Waters.
Positioned within the highly regarded ‘The Beaches’ precinct, this substantial five-bedroom residence offers a great combination of space, comfort and lifestyle in one of Pelican Waters’ most desirable locations.
Designed with family living in mind, the home spans two generous levels and provides a flexible layout that caters to both everyday living and entertaining. Surrounded by established homes in a quality neighbourhood, it delivers a relaxed coastal feel with plenty of room to grow.
As you enter, the home immediately opens up to light-filled interiors and a practical floorplan. Neutral tones and tiled flooring create a clean, easy-care environment, with an evident sense of space throughout.
At the centre of the home, the kitchen is both functional and well-appointed, featuring Caesarstone benchtops, stainless steel appliances and a freestanding 900mm gas oven. Overlooking the main living and dining areas, it connects effortlessly to the covered alfresco and outdoor entertaining space.
The outdoor area is ideal for hosting or unwinding, complete with an in-ground swimming pool and cascade water feature, offering a private setting for family and friends to enjoy.
Accommodation includes five bedrooms and four bathrooms, providing flexibility for larger families or those needing extra space. The master suite is well sized, featuring a walk-in robe and ensuite with spa bath, while the remaining bedrooms all include built-in robes.
Multiple living areas are spread throughout the home, including a dedicated games or media room equipped with a built-in speaker system — perfect for entertaining or relaxing.
Additional features include ducted air-conditioning, ceiling fans, timber flooring, intercom system, ducted vacuum and Crimsafe security screens. A double lock-up garage offers secure parking and storage, with the added benefit of side access for a trailer or caravan.
Set on a fully fenced block, the home is conveniently located close to local parks, schools, shopping centres and beaches. The nearby Pelican Waters Golf Course and emerging marina precinct further enhance the lifestyle appeal of this location.
Offering space, functionality and a highly sought-after address, this is a home that will suit families looking for both comfort and convenience.
